San Jose State, Cisco high-tech deal ran into problem at outset

2014-12-27 22:50:57| Wireless - Topix.net

San Jose State got a steep discount on Cisco products for a $28 million technology upgrade it launched in 2012, but there was a catch: The deal was good for only six months. In the first four weeks alone -- for a project expected to span five years -- San Jose State ordered more than $16 million worth of products and services from Cisco reseller Nexus IS and later stashed the gear in storage areas across the campus.
